Your Guide to Undercounter Water Filters

Tired of bottled water? Want cleaner, tastier water right from your tap? An undercounter water filter might be your perfect solution! These handy systems hide away under your sink, giving you great-tasting water without cluttering your countertop. Let’s explore what makes a good undercounter filter.

Key Features to Look For

  • Filtration Stages: More stages usually mean cleaner water. Look for filters with at least two or three stages. These can include sediment filters (to catch dirt and rust), activated carbon filters (to remove chlorine and bad tastes), and sometimes specialized filters for things like lead or heavy metals.
  • Filter Lifespan: How often do you need to change the filters? Some last for 6 months, while others can go for a year or more. Longer-lasting filters save you time and money.
  • Flow Rate: This is how fast the water comes out of your faucet. A good flow rate means you won’t have to wait long for a glass of water.
  • Easy Installation: Some systems are easier to install than others. If you’re not a DIY expert, look for models with clear instructions and helpful videos.
  • Certifications: Look for seals from organizations like NSF International. These certifications mean the filter has been tested and proven to remove specific contaminants.

Important Materials

The materials used in your filter matter. The housing, where the filter cartridges sit, is usually made of strong plastic. The filter media itself is where the magic happens.

  • Activated Carbon: This is a common and effective material. It’s made from charcoal and has a very porous surface that traps impurities.
  • Ceramic: Some filters use ceramic to catch larger particles.
  • Specialty Media: For removing specific things like lead or bacteria, special materials are used.

What Makes a Filter Great (or Not So Great)

Factors That Improve Quality
  • High-Quality Filter Media: The better the materials inside the filter, the more contaminants it can remove.
  • Multiple Filtration Stages: Each stage tackles different types of impurities, leading to a more thorough clean.
  • Good Seals and Connections: This prevents leaks and ensures water only goes through the filter.
  • Reputable Brand: Established brands often have better quality control and customer support.
Factors That Reduce Quality
  • Cheap Materials: Low-quality plastic or filter media might not work as well or could break down.
  • Poor Construction: Leaky housings or loose connections are a problem.
  • Lack of Certifications: Without testing, you can’t be sure what the filter actually removes.
  • Infrequent Filter Changes: Old filters become clogged and stop working effectively.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What is an undercounter water filter?

A: It’s a water filtration system that sits out of sight under your kitchen sink.

Q: Do I need a separate faucet for filtered water?

A: Some systems come with a dedicated faucet, while others connect to your existing one.

Q: How often do I need to change the filters?

A: This depends on the filter model, but it’s usually every 6 to 12 months.

Q: Can undercounter filters remove lead?

A: Many can, but you need to check the filter’s specifications and certifications to be sure.

Q: Are they hard to install?

A: Installation varies, but many are designed for DIYers with basic tools.

Q: Will it slow down my water flow?

A: Some flow reduction is normal, but good filters have a decent flow rate.

Q: What contaminants do these filters typically remove?

A: They often remove chlorine, sediment, bad tastes, and odors. Some remove more specific things like heavy metals.

Q: Are they expensive?

A: The initial cost varies, and you’ll also have ongoing costs for replacement filters.

Q: Can I use it for more than just drinking water?

A: Yes, you can use filtered water for cooking, making ice, and even for your coffee maker.

Q: What’s the difference between undercounter and countertop filters?

A: Undercounter filters are hidden, while countertop filters sit on your sink.
